About this program

The Advanced Manufacturing - Machining Certificate at Onondaga Community College provides students with a comprehensive understanding of modern machining techniques and advanced manufacturing processes. The program covers a wide array of topics, including CNC machining, blueprint reading, precision measuring, and the operation of various machining tools. Students will gain hands-on experience with state-of-the-art equipment, which prepares them to meet the demands of the rapidly evolving manufacturing industry.

This diploma program is designed for individuals looking to enhance their skill set for a competitive edge in the machining sector. The curriculum is structured to include both theoretical knowledge and practical application, allowing students to acquire essential skills such as problem-solving, critical thinking, and technical proficiency in manufacturing processes. Interactive workshops and lab sessions further enrich the learning experience, fostering creativity and innovation.

Entry requirements

Applicants are typically required to have a high school diploma or equivalent. It is beneficial for candidates to possess a foundational knowledge of mathematics and engineering principles. Those with prior experience or coursework in related fields may have an advantage in the admissions process.

English:

International students are generally expected to demonstrate proficiency in English through standard tests such as IELTS or TOEFL. A minimum score of 6.0 on the IELTS or 79 on the TOEFL is often recommended, but these requirements may vary, so it is advisable to check the specific criteria.

International students:

International students must obtain a valid student visa to study in the university's country. Required documents may include proof of admission, financial statements, and valid identification. It is crucial for prospective students to consult official immigration resources or the university's international office to ensure compliance with all regulations.
